Technology for all will provide a platform with tools and techniques to use for the community people. It will be a place for learning, making, collaborating and sharing ideas and knowledge. A community-operated workspace where people with common interests, often in computers, machining, technology, science, digital or electronic art can meet, socialize and collaborate. Technology for all will be organizing workshops, seminars and events where people can learn from the expert of the technological field. It will provide an opportunity to young people to explore one’s own interests; learn to use tools and materials, both physical and virtual; and develop creative projects. It will provide hands on learning, help with critical thinking skills and even boost self-confidence.
